Foundation Website Agent Build

Starting at $15,000 About 30 days

A custom website rebuild, a dedicated Mac mini, a trained AI website agent, and a practical handoff for the team that will run it.

  • Full website build or migration to a modern stack
  • Mac mini setup for your internal build workflow
  • AI workflow setup and launch process
  • Team training for day-to-day production updates
